Descripción: El Protocolo de Servicio de Directorio X.500 es un conjunto de estándares que define cómo acceder y gestionar servicios de directorio en redes informáticas. Este protocolo permite la organización y el acceso a información sobre recursos de red, como usuarios, dispositivos y servicios, facilitando la administración de grandes bases de datos distribuidas. X.500 se basa en un modelo jerárquico que organiza la información en una estructura de árbol, donde cada nodo puede contener datos sobre diferentes entidades. Este enfoque permite una búsqueda eficiente y una gestión centralizada de la información. Además, X.500 utiliza el Protocolo de Acceso a Directorios (DAP) para la comunicación entre clientes y servidores, lo que garantiza la interoperabilidad entre diferentes sistemas y plataformas. La seguridad y la autenticación son aspectos clave en X.500, ya que permiten el control de acceso a la información sensible. En resumen, el Protocolo de Servicio de Directorio X.500 es fundamental para la gestión de identidades y recursos en entornos de red complejos, proporcionando una base sólida para la implementación de servicios de directorio en diversas aplicaciones.
Historia: El Protocolo de Servicio de Directorio X.500 fue desarrollado en la década de 1980 por la Unión Internacional de Telecomunicaciones (UIT) como parte de la serie de recomendaciones X. Se diseñó para proporcionar un marco estándar para la gestión de información en redes de telecomunicaciones. A medida que las redes se expandieron y se volvieron más complejas, la necesidad de un sistema de directorio robusto se hizo evidente, lo que llevó a la adopción de X.500 en diversas aplicaciones empresariales y gubernamentales. A lo largo de los años, se han desarrollado extensiones y adaptaciones del protocolo, incluyendo LDAP (Protocolo Ligero de Acceso a Directorios), que simplifica el acceso a los servicios de directorio.
Usos: El Protocolo de Servicio de Directorio X.500 se utiliza principalmente en entornos empresariales para gestionar información sobre usuarios, dispositivos y servicios en redes complejas. Permite la autenticación de usuarios y el control de acceso a recursos, lo que es crucial para la seguridad de la información. Además, se utiliza en aplicaciones de correo electrónico y servicios de directorio, donde facilita la búsqueda de direcciones y la gestión de contactos. También es común en sistemas de gestión de identidades y en la implementación de políticas de seguridad en organizaciones.
Ejemplos: Un ejemplo práctico del uso de X.500 es en sistemas de correo electrónico corporativo, donde se utiliza para gestionar la información de contacto de los empleados y facilitar la búsqueda de direcciones. Otro ejemplo es su implementación en sistemas de gestión de identidades, donde se utiliza para autenticar usuarios y controlar el acceso a aplicaciones y recursos dentro de una organización. Además, algunas organizaciones gubernamentales utilizan X.500 para gestionar bases de datos de ciudadanos y servicios públicos.